Abstract:Down syndrome (DS) is the leading cause of intellectual disability, yet the factors contributing to its occurrence remain largely unknown. In this study, we investigated the genetic influence of the C677T variant in the meth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R) gene, alongside maternal age, family history, and miscarriages, on the development of DS.
